When you are storing a DataFrame object into a csv file using the to_csv method, you probably wont be needing to store the preceding indices of each row of the DataFrame object. You can avoid that by passing a False boolean value to index parameter. Somewhat like: df.to_csv(file_name, encoding='utf-8', index=False)The comma separated value (CSV) file type is used because of its versatility. However, other symbols can be …CSV File Format. CSV file format is known to be specified under RFC4180. It defines any file to be CSV compliant if: Each record is located on a separate line, delimited by a line break (CRLF). For example: aaa,bbb,ccc CRLF. zzz,yyy,xxx CRLF. The last record in the file may or may not have an ending line break. For example:

The CSV file format uses essential comma characters to delimit ... The csv module defines the following functions: csv.reader(csvfile, dialect='excel', **fmtparams) ¶. Return a reader object that will process lines from the given csvfile. A csvfile must be an iterable of strings, each in the reader’s defined csv format. A csvfile is most commonly a file-like object or list. mounument valley In the world of data and spreadsheets, two file formats stand out: Excel XLSX and CSV. In that case, it is a situation ...Let's consider the steps to open a basic CSV file and parse the data it contains: Use FileReader to open the CSV file. Create a BufferedReader and read the file line by line until an "End of File" ( EOF) character is reached. Use the String.split() method to identify the comma delimiter and split the row into fields.The COPY statement can be used to load data from a CSV file into a table.
